Heavy-Duty Railway Screw Spikes for Track Fastening Systems
Railway screw spikes (also known as track bolts or hex lag screws) are the backbone of modern rail fastening systems. Designed to secure rails to timber or concrete sleepers, our spikes provide superior pull-out resistance and vibration damping compared to traditional cut spikes.

Technical Specifications
| Feature | Specification Details |
|---|---|
| Standard | ASTM F568, BS 7371, ISO 898-1, AREMA |
| Diameter | M16, M20, M22, M24, M27, M30 |
| Length | 100mm – 300mm (Custom lengths available) |
| Material | Carbon Steel (C45, 40Cr), Alloy Steel (20MnTiB) |
| Grade | 5.8, 8.8, 10.9, 12.9 |
| Thread Pitch | Coarse (Standard) / Fine (Custom) |
| Drive Type | Hex Head (with Flange), Square Head |
Material & Corrosion Protection
Railway environments are harsh. We offer specialized treatments to ensure longevity:
Materials: We use high-tensile 40B or 35CrMo alloy steel, heat-treated to achieve a hardness of HRC 32-38, preventing thread stripping under high torque.
Hot Dip Galvanized (HDG): Standard for outdoor tracks (Zinc coating ≥45μm).
Dacromet / Geomet: Ideal for high-corrosion coastal areas (Salt spray test >1000 hours).
Epoxy Coated: Provides electrical insulation for signaling tracks.
Applications
Our screw spikes are engineered for critical infrastructure:
Railway Tracks: Fixing rails to timber sleepers and concrete beams.
Subway & Metro Systems: Vibration-damping fasteners for urban transit.
Crane Rails: Securing heavy-duty crane tracks in ports and factories.
Mine Tracks: High-strength fixing for underground mining railways.
How to Select the Right Railway Spike?
Choosing the correct spike depends on your sleeper material and load requirements:
For Timber Sleepers: Use Hex Head Screw Spikes with a coarse thread pitch for maximum grip in wood fibers.
For Concrete Sleepers: Use Shoulder Screws or spikes designed for pre-installed plastic dowels (sleeves).
For High-Vibration Areas: Select spikes with Nyloc patches or use spring washers to prevent loosening.
FAQ
Q1: What is the difference between a screw spike and a cut spike?
A screw spike has threads and a hex head, allowing it to be screwed in for higher holding power. A cut spike is smooth and hammered in, suitable only for light-duty timber tracks.
